Liam Payne's girlfriend Kate Cassidy was left devastated when a memory from just 12 months ago popped up on Snapchat, as she mourns the One Direction singer's death Liam Payne's girlfriend Kate Cassidy has shared a heartbreaking memory with the One Direction star – taken just a year ago. Liam tragically died when he fell off his balcony in Argentina, leaving the world in mourning. Kate was dating Liam at the time and has been open about her devastation following the loss of the star – who's final TV appearance is set to air later this month. Now Kate has shared a heartbreaking memory of her and Liam, which she posted on her Instagram. In the video taken a year ago, they were documenting a late night walk together, making each other laugh. ‌ Alongside the clip, she wrote: "This popped up on my one year ago Snapchat. I miss you." The pair were in hysterics in the video, which was taken last July - months before Liam lost his life. ‌ Speaking earlier this year, she opened up about her grief and strong bond with Liam. She said: "It's still so special, I see it so often and it's going to be something that's going to be involved in my life forever. Every time I see the number four, I know he's there with me. "I never thought I'd ever be in a position being with Liam in general but he's guided me so much, he's taught me to have thick skin and that people are going to say different things, and people are going to have different opinions, and to not let anybody's opinion get to me as he never let it get to him." She was in tears as she added: "I find myself talking about him so much in the present tense and it's something where I don't even feel the need to correct myself because that's part of my healing journey. I'm still working on accepting the fact that he's not here anymore so it's hard for me to refer to him in the past tense. When I do refer to him in the past tense, it almost stings that little bit more, because it's more official. I never thought that I'd be talking about him in the past tense so it's definitely really hard to accept." Kate wears a necklace with angel wings on to remind her of Liam. Speaking about their piece of jewellery, she said: "I actually saw it in a little gift shop a couple of weeks ago and I felt like it spoke to me and it matches my angel wings tattoos. I wear it quite often and once again it makes me feel that bit closer to Liam." She was speaking in support of Lorraine's March4March campaign. She had said: "For people that aren't familiar with the number four, it's mine and Liam's angel number which symbolises support and guidance from your angels, and I genuinely believe that Liam guided me to this campaign and wanted me to be involved in this to help other people. It's something that he wanted me to do."

ITV gives update on Lorraine Kelly's return to TV after surgery She will be joined by Dr Hilary Jones Lorraine Kelly (Image: ITV ) Lorraine Kelly is set to return to TV screens on Monday, May 19, following her recent surgery. Lorraine will be joined live on air by the show's resident GP Dr Hilary Jones as she talks about her experience having undergone surgery to remove her fallopian tubes and ovaries, ITV said on Friday. The unrivalled queen of daytime television with a career spanning more than 40 years, Lorraine continues to remain a mainstay in British television, using her programme and platform to raise awareness for social and medical causes as well as breaking taboos through her broadcasting. ‌ Women's health remains at the forefront of the programme's agenda-setting conversations, and ITV said Monday's show would be no different, as Lorraine will shed light on the importance of ovarian health as well as the signs and preventative measures viewers can take in a bid to avert and overcome female cancers. Article continues below The programme's commitment to social purpose work recently saw Lorraine and her Change + Check Choir receive a royal invitation to perform in front of the King and Queen in acknowledgement for the show's dedication to raising awareness for breast cancer. Lorraine also airs March4March and No Butts campaigns broadcast in support of mental health and bowel cancer initiatives. Viewers can join Lorraine Kelly and Dr Hilary Jones on Lorraine from 9am on ITV1, ITVX, STV and STV Player.

Kelsey Parker is nearing the end of her pregnancy and she proudly showed off her bump in glowing new snaps over the bank holiday weekend. The widow of late The Wanted star Tom Parker was bathing in the rays in her back garden in a series of photos she posted on social media. Relaxing in a hot tub, 34-year-old Kelsey looked ecstatic as she posed for multiple pictures, cradling her stomach. She slipped her bump into a classy black one-piece, accessorising with some sunglasses. Mum-of-two Kelsey - who shares Aurelia, five, and Bodhi, four, with Tom - captioned her photos: 'Soaking up the sun this Bank Holiday weekend and clearly very happy about it ☀️ Wearing — honestly the best pregnancy swimwear ever!!' Kelsey is the widow of Tom, who tragically died from brain cancer in 2022, at the age of just 33. The Sun revealed last year that Kelsey had found love with tree surgeon Will Lindsay, two years after Tom's death. Ahead of welcoming her and Will's baby, she revealed she has been getting a lot of hate online but her new partner has been very supportive and told her to 'block out the haters'. Speaking on ITV's Lorraine, in their first joint interview together, Kelsey explained: 'It's been three years, this is Tom's three year anniversary of his death and it's almost like people want me to feel guilty for moving on.' Kelsey was devastated after husband Tom lost his battle with brain cancer aged just 33, four years after they tied the knot. She found love again last year, meeting Kent tree surgeon Will on a night out. They announced their romance last September and Kelsey, who is due in June, previously revealed her third pregnancy was a 'happy accident'. Speaking on the ITV daytime show to mark Lorraine's March4March mental health initiative, The Mirror report that Kelsey asked Will: 'Does it stress you out that I get upset about trolls and people commenting on our relationship?' Will replied: 'Not really, I just tell you not to look at them don't I. There's bound to be some people sending nice messages but block out the haters.' She added: 'I'm always going to have guilt but what's so hard is that Tom's not here anymore so what do people want me to do? 'Our house was full of so much sadness but now it's full of happiness, the kids deserve that more than anything. 'They've been through so much, I feel like we are taking the steps forward to heal but I just want other women to feel like it's OK to move on, it's not taking anything away from the love I had for Tom.' Kelsey also opened up about the impact meeting Will has had on her life and how trolls don't 'understand how she feels' because they are not in her shoes. She started dating tree surgeon Lindsay last year, and told how her partner lives with her at the home she shared with Tom and the kids, remarking how he 'gradually moved in' when the time 'felt right'. The couple stated that they didn't have a preference about the baby's sex and were currently 'undecided' about whether they wanted to know - as the answer is waiting for them in an email.

Kate Cassidy admits it's still 'really hard to accept' the loss of her boyfriend, former One Direction singer Liam Payne, more than four months after his death. Cassidy became visibly emotional Wednesday while discussing Payne during an appearance on the British morning show 'Lorraine.' 'I find myself talking about him so much in the present tense,' she said. 'I don't even feel the need to correct myself because that's part of my healing journey. I'm still working on accepting the fact that he's not here anymore, so it's hard for me to refer to him in the past tense.' 'When I do refer to him in the past tense, it almost stings that little bit more,' she continued. Watch Kate Cassidy's interview on 'Lorraine' below. Payne was found dead Oct. 16 after falling from the third-floor balcony of a hotel in the Palermo neighborhood of Buenos Aires, Argentina. He was 31. A toxicology report found that the pop singer had multiple substances in his system at the time of his death, including cocaine, crack cocaine and benzodiazepine. In December, Argentine authorities indicted five people ― including three employees at the hotel where Payne had been staying ― in connection with the singer's death. Cassidy had been by Payne's side at the start of his Argentina visit. On Oct. 2, the two were spotted at Layne's former One Direction bandmate Niall Horan's concert at Buenos Aires' Movistar Arena. Just days before Payne's death, Cassidy confirmed on social media that she'd returned to the U.S. while he stayed behind in Argentina. Elsewhere in her 'Lorraine' interview, Cassidy said she was finding solace in her dog, Nala, whom she had shared with Payne. 'I have my better days, I have my harder days,' she said. 'But I'm surrounded by such a great support system that I cannot thank enough, and having Nala around as well, obviously, again has helped me so much with my healing journey.' Cassidy's 'Lorraine' appearance was meant to promote March4March, a mental health advocacy campaign. In her interview, she said her decision to take part in the campaign was, in part, intended as a tribute to Payne. 'I generally believe Liam, in a way, guided me to this campaign and wanted me to get involved in this and to help other people,' she said. 'It's something he would've wanted me to do.'
